<html><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; "><font class="Apple-style-span" face="Courier">Hi!</font><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">(sorry for the HTML mail, but otherwise the long lines are broken).<br></font><div><font class="Apple-style-span" face="Courier"><br></font><div><div><font class="Apple-style-span" face="Courier">Am 18.11.2008 um 07:51 schrieb Trygve Laugstøl:</font></div><blockquote type="cite"><div><font class="Apple-style-span" face="Courier">I agree with Phil here, we need two packages. I would never use JDK or <br>JRE package that has been modified by upstream packages, just see the <br>just that Debian tries deliver with their "java" packages.<br></font></div></blockquote></div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">I am currently looking into the JDK/JRE issue. The idea is</font></div><div><font class="Apple-style-span" face="Courier">to have a CSWjre6 package containing the JRE and a CSWjdk6</font></div><div><font class="Apple-style-span" face="Courier">package, which depends on CSWjre6 and adds the JDK.</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">So, the layout will look like this:</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jdk/latest</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">links to ../jdk6 (or jdk7 later)</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">CSWjdk (depends on CSWjdk6)</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jdk6</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">links to jdk1.6.0_07 (or _08 later)</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">CSWjdk6</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jdk1.6.0_07</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">contains stuff from archive</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                </font></span><font class="Apple-style-span" face="Courier">CSWjdk6</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jdk1.6.0_07/jre</font><span class="Apple-tab-span" style="white-space: pre; "><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">contains JRE inside JDK</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                        </font></span><font class="Apple-style-span" face="Courier">CSWjre6</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jre/latest</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">links to ../jre6</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                        </font></span><font class="Apple-style-span" face="Courier">CSWjre (depends on CSWjre6)</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jre6</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                </font></span><font class="Apple-style-span" face="Courier">links to jre1.6.0_07</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                        </font></span><font class="Apple-style-span" face="Courier">CSWjre6</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jre1.6.0_07</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">links to jdk1.6.0_07/jre</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                </font></span><font class="Apple-style-span" face="Courier">CSWjre6</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/man</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                </font></span><font class="Apple-style-span" face="Courier">links to ../jdk/latest/man</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                </font></span><font class="Apple-style-span" face="Courier">CSWjre</font></div><div><font class="Apple-style-span" face="Courier"> /opt/csw/java/jre6/man</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">        </font></span><font class="Apple-style-span" face="Courier">links to ../../jdk6/man</font><span class="Apple-tab-span" style="white-space:pre"><font class="Apple-style-span" face="Courier">                        </font></span><font class="Apple-style-span" face="Courier">CSWjre</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">I compared the JRE embedded in the JDK. The following files</font></div><div><font class="Apple-style-span" face="Courier">are only in jdk1.6.0_07/jre:</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ier"> lib/sparc/libsaproc.so</font></div><div><font class="Apple-style-span" face="Courier"> lib/sparcv9/libsaproc.so</font></div><div><font class="Apple-style-span" face="Courier"> lib/sparc/libattach.so</font></div><div><font class="Apple-style-span" face="Courier"> lib/sparcv9/libattach.so</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">What are these for? Just take the JRE from the JDK add them to the CSWjre6?</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">When the permit from Sun arrives I'll give the package</font></div><div><font class="Apple-style-span" face="Courier">a final shot.</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ier">Best regards</font></div><div><font class="Apple-style-span" face="Courier"><br></font></div><div><font class="Apple-style-span" face="Courier"> -- Dago</font></div></div></body></html>